Tropical North Queensland

Tropical North Queensland’s largest city, Cairns is a popular international tourist destination and home to an international airport. Proximity to the Great Barrier Reef and south-east Asian ports also makes Cairns a popular cruising destination. The Cairns region is capable of handling superyachts up to 135m across six marina facilities, with Five-star dedicated superyacht services available at Cairns Marlin Marina and Ports North having the capability of berthing superyachts up to 200m.
